Spurgeons Estate Garages - Greening Project
Notice Description
INTRODUCTION The London Borough of Lambeth "The Client" is seeking to appoint suitably qualified and skilled greening contractors to supply greening on estates on the North Area of the borough. We would like to carry out greening improvements on the estate to improve the current aesthetic by using greening to address fly tipping spots, improve green landscaping and installation of additional plant life around the estate. The London Borough of Lambeth needs to procure the following items across on Spurgeon estate garages: * Installation of a green roof on top of 23 garages located on the estate * Possible additional survey of the garages * Possible installation of railings on top of garages for access to space depending on final design solution * Possible installation of concrete access steps depending on final design solution * Engagement with residents, Tenants and Resident Associations (TRAs), Garage occupiers and Local Councillors on the estate to aid in design and delivery of the scheme is a must so please confirm the strategy you will be using to engage residents and include price for this in the tender You will be required to provide a high quality service for Lambeth citizens and to invest in high quality services, materials and workmanship to maximise the life expectancy of the greening works. You must be able to carry out the work from start to finish. You can submit quotes for one or two of the contracted areas. The expectation will be for works to start on site by June 21 2020 weather permitting. A survey by our structural engineer team highlighted that the garage structure is structurally adequate to support the proposed green roof (imposed load of 250kg/m2). Further detail about the garage can be found attached to the tender email. The council is in the process of assessing the standard of the concrete movement joints. We would advise you to visit the site independently to help work up ideas for your tender. The address is; Spurgeon Estate, Stockwell, London SW8 1UL It is expected that discount would apply if you successfully bid for 2 of the contract areas. Evaluation criteria Responses to the invitation to quote will be assessed according to the following criteria; 60% price and 40% quality and technical. Zero score in any of the evaluation question will result in automatic disqualification. Quality, assessed on the basis of 8 weighted questions. The questions and their weights are attached Please complete the Schedule of Rates in the attachments. The Price score will be calculated using the formula: (Lowest price / by tendered price X 60) Your rates should be inclusive of set up costs and all the specification requirements related to these work components including data management etc. Price and quality scores will be added together and the Contract will be awarded to the highest scoring submission. References Please provide two references detailing; *Project undertaken *Client contact number and e-mail address Additional information: The contract start and end dates are provisional dates and are dependent on Covid-19, seasonal variations, and the contractors own timelines. The dates are provided as a guide for potential bidders
